exemples de diagrammes séquence plantUML

This commit is contained in:
2025-11-14 09:58:19 +01:00
parent 64042682a3
commit 1db2933993
3 changed files with 36 additions and 2 deletions

View File

@@ -0,0 +1,12 @@
-- Exemple tiré de la documentation
-- utilie des abbréviations
@startuml
alice -> bob ++ : hello
bob -> bob ++ : self call
bob -> bib ++ #005500 : hello
bob -> george ** : create
return done
return rc
bob -> george !! : delete
return success
@enduml

View File

@@ -0,0 +1,22 @@
-- Exemple tiré de la documentation
-- utilie des abbréviations
@startuml
autonumber
participant "VueJardin:Pape14" as v
participant "Parcelle:p0" as p0
participant "Parcelle:p1" as p1
participant "Parcelle:p2" as p2
participant "Parcelle:p3" as p3
v -> p0 ++ : getSplit()
return V
v -> p0 ++ : getFirst()
return p1
v -> v ++ : setParcelleVisible(p1)
v --
v -> p1 ++ : getSplit()
return H
v -> p1 ++ : reset()
p1 -> p2 !! : delete
p1 -> p3 !! : delete
return
@enduml

View File

@@ -1,8 +1,8 @@
# PlantUML
alternative à starUML pour générer des diagrammes UML.
PlantUML est une alternative à starUML pour générer des diagrammes UML que nous allons utiliser dans le cadre de ce cours.
Différence principale : du texte qu'on peut écrire dans un éditeur de texte plutôt qu'un cliquodrome.
Différence principale avec StarUML: du texte qu'on peut écrire dans un éditeur de texte plutôt qu'un cliquodrome.
Pour l'instant pas de rendu possible dans le markdown du serveur git.